웹 프론트엔드 View.js Vue에서 오류를 처리하는 방법

Vue에서 오류를 처리하는 방법

Apr 30, 2024 am 05:24 AM
vue

Vue 오류 처리 방법은 다음과 같습니다. 1. 예외를 잡기 위해 try-catch 문을 사용합니다. 2. 전역 오류 처리기를 정의합니다. 3. 오류 세부 정보를 출력합니다. 5. 항상 오류 처리와 같은 모범 사례를 따릅니다. , 의미 있는 오류 메시지를 사용하고, 오류를 기록하고, 프로덕션 환경 오류를 모니터링합니다.

Vue에서 오류를 처리하는 방법

Vue에서 오류를 처리하는 방법

Vue.js는 개발자가 애플리케이션의 문제를 식별하고 해결하는 데 도움이 되는 강력한 오류 처리 메커니즘을 제공하는 인기 있는 프런트 엔드 프레임워크입니다.

시작하기

Vue 오류를 처리하는 일반적인 방법은 try-catch 문을 사용하여 예외를 잡는 것입니다. try-catch 语句来捕获异常。

try {
  // 有可能引发错误的代码
} catch (error) {
  // 处理错误的逻辑
}
로그인 후 복사

使用全局错误处理程序

Vue 还提供了全局错误处理程序,可以在应用程序的根实例中定义。这允许您为所有未捕获的错误设置一个中心处理程序。

Vue.config.errorHandler = function (err, vm, info) {
  // 处理错误的逻辑
}
로그인 후 복사

错误详细信息

error 参数提供有关错误的详细信息,包括:

  • message:错误消息
  • name:错误类型
  • stack:错误堆栈跟踪

显示错误

可以使用 Vue.util.warn() 函数将错误消息输出到控制台或其他位置。

Vue.util.warn('错误消息')
로그인 후 복사

自定义错误

Vue 允许您创建自定义错误,可以通过扩展 Error

class MyError extends Error {
  constructor(message) {
    super(message)
  }
}
로그인 후 복사

전역 오류 처리기 사용

Vue는 응용 프로그램의 루트 인스턴스에서 정의할 수 있는 전역 오류 처리기도 제공합니다. 이를 통해 포착되지 않은 모든 오류에 대한 중앙 처리기를 설정할 수 있습니다.
    rrreee
  • 오류 세부정보
  • error 매개변수는 다음을 포함하여 오류에 대한 자세한 정보를 제공합니다.
  • message: 오류 메시지
🎜이름 code&gt; code&gt;: 오류 유형 🎜🎜 <code>stack: 오류 스택 추적 🎜🎜🎜🎜 오류 표시 🎜🎜🎜 Vue.util.warn() 함수를 사용하여 다음을 수행할 수 있습니다. 콘솔이나 다른 위치에 오류 메시지를 출력합니다. 🎜rrreee🎜🎜Custom Errors🎜🎜🎜Vue를 사용하면 Error 클래스를 확장하여 사용자 정의 오류를 생성할 수 있습니다. 🎜rrreee🎜🎜Best Practices🎜🎜🎜🎜항상 오류를 처리하고 무시하지 마세요. 🎜🎜의미 있는 오류 메시지를 사용하세요. 🎜🎜콘솔 및 UI의 오류를 기록합니다. 🎜🎜프로덕션 환경에 오류가 있는지 모니터링하여 문제를 빠르게 식별하세요. 🎜🎜

위 내용은 Vue에서 오류를 처리하는 방법의 상세 내용입니다. 자세한 내용은 PHP 중국어 웹사이트의 기타 관련 기사를 참조하세요!

본 웹사이트의 성명
본 글의 내용은 네티즌들의 자발적인 기여로 작성되었으며, 저작권은 원저작자에게 있습니다. 본 사이트는 이에 상응하는 법적 책임을 지지 않습니다. 표절이나 침해가 의심되는 콘텐츠를 발견한 경우 admin@php.cn으로 문의하세요.

뜨거운 기사 태그

메모장++7.3.1

메모장++7.3.1

사용하기 쉬운 무료 코드 편집기

SublimeText3 중국어 버전

SublimeText3 중국어 버전

중국어 버전, 사용하기 매우 쉽습니다.

스튜디오 13.0.1 보내기

스튜디오 13.0.1 보내기

강력한 PHP 통합 개발 환경

드림위버 CS6

드림위버 CS6

시각적 웹 개발 도구

SublimeText3 Mac 버전

SublimeText3 Mac 버전

신 수준의 코드 편집 소프트웨어(SublimeText3)

vue에서 echart를 사용하는 방법 vue에서 echart를 사용하는 방법 May 09, 2024 pm 04:24 PM

vue에서 echart를 사용하는 방법

vue에서 내보내기 기본값의 역할 vue에서 내보내기 기본값의 역할 May 09, 2024 pm 06:48 PM

vue에서 내보내기 기본값의 역할

Vue에서 지도 기능을 사용하는 방법 Vue에서 지도 기능을 사용하는 방법 May 09, 2024 pm 06:54 PM

Vue에서 지도 기능을 사용하는 방법

vue에서 이벤트와 $event의 차이점 vue에서 이벤트와 $event의 차이점 May 08, 2024 pm 04:42 PM

vue에서 이벤트와 $event의 차이점

vue에서 내보내기와 내보내기 기본값의 차이점 vue에서 내보내기와 내보내기 기본값의 차이점 May 08, 2024 pm 05:27 PM

vue에서 내보내기와 내보내기 기본값의 차이점

vue에서 onmounted의 역할 vue에서 onmounted의 역할 May 09, 2024 pm 02:51 PM

vue에서 onmounted의 역할

vue에 마운트된 것은 반응의 수명 주기에 해당합니다. vue에 마운트된 것은 반응의 수명 주기에 해당합니다. May 09, 2024 pm 01:42 PM

vue에 마운트된 것은 반응의 수명 주기에 해당합니다.

Vue의 후크는 무엇입니까 Vue의 후크는 무엇입니까 May 09, 2024 pm 06:33 PM

Vue의 후크는 무엇입니까

See all articles